Discover the captivating allure of Victorian artistry with this ceramic tile collection by William De Morgan, one of the pivotal figures of the Arts and Crafts Movement. The set, originating from De Morgan's Sands End workshop in Fulham between 1888 and 1897, is a part of the esteemed De Morgan Collection. Once part of a large fire screen, these tiles now stand as individual art pieces, adding charm and history to your living space. Each tile features vibrantly-colored parrots perched on grapevines, a motif that intertwines the beauty of nature with the sophistication of ceramic artistry. De Morgan's ingenious use of the watercolor technique breathes life into the parrots, their colors gleaming against the earthen ceramic backdrop. The set pieces in this collection feature two different motifs and two mirrored connector tiles, meticulously designed to form a cohesive visual narrative. The parrots, symbols of communication and socialization, alongside the grapevine, often associated with abundance and transformation, form a powerful emblem of growth, prosperity, and community. This tile collection carries De Morgan's distinct signature - a fusion of natural themes with innovative art techniques.
